与at(1)守护进程对话,为以后安排作业
unix-at的Python项目详细描述
这个小库允许您与大多数unix机器上可用的at(1)系统对话,以安排稍后运行的作业。
在(1)中使用比运行诸如Celery这样的成熟的作业处理系统要轻得多,但是如果运行的任务非常少,则性能会低得多。
示例
importunix_atjob=unix_at.submit_shell_job(['touch','/some/file'])unix_at.cancel_job(job)job=unix_at.submit_python_job(os.mkdir,'now + 1 hour','/some/dir')